Analysis

In 2024, multilateral debt service in Belarus stood at 476.18 million TDS, current US$.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 1.1% on the previous year and up 15.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, multilateral debt service in Belarus peaked at 1.15 billion TDS, current US$ in 2012 and was at its lowest, 5.06 million TDS, current US$, in 2010.

That places Belarus 44th out of 122 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Public and publicly guaranteed multilateral loans include loans and credits from the World Bank, regional development banks, and other multilateral and intergovernmental agencies. Excluded are loans from funds administered by an international organization on behalf of a single donor government; these are classified as loans from governments. Debt service payments are the sum of principal repayments and interest payments actually made in the year specified.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
